AI Agents for Sentiment Analysis: A Complete Guide for Developers, Tech Professionals, and Busine...

Did you know that 85% of customer interactions will be handled without human agents by 2025, according to Gartner? This shift makes AI-powered sentiment analysis essential for understanding customer e

By Ramesh Kumar |
AI technology illustration for neural network

AI Agents for Sentiment Analysis: A Complete Guide for Developers, Tech Professionals, and Business Leaders

Key Takeaways

  • AI agents for sentiment analysis automate the process of extracting emotional tone from text data at scale
  • Machine learning models like transformers and LSTMs power modern sentiment analysis with over 90% accuracy in some cases
  • Businesses use sentiment analysis for customer feedback, market research, and brand monitoring
  • Proper implementation requires clean data, model fine-tuning, and continuous evaluation
  • Tools like micro-agent-by-builder simplify deployment for production environments

Introduction

Did you know that 85% of customer interactions will be handled without human agents by 2025, according to Gartner? This shift makes AI-powered sentiment analysis essential for understanding customer emotions at scale.

AI agents for sentiment analysis combine natural language processing (NLP) with machine learning to classify text as positive, negative, or neutral. This guide explains how these systems work, their business benefits, and best practices for implementation. We’ll cover technical foundations for developers and strategic insights for business leaders.

AI technology illustration for data science

What Is AI Agents for Sentiment Analysis?

AI agents for sentiment analysis are autonomous systems that process textual data to determine emotional tone, opinion polarity, or subjective intent. Unlike basic keyword scanning, these agents understand context, sarcasm, and nuanced expressions through advanced NLP techniques.

For example, Sourcely can analyse thousands of product reviews in minutes, identifying sentiment trends that would take humans weeks to process. Financial institutions use similar tools to gauge market sentiment from news articles and social media.

Core Components

  • Text preprocessing: Tokenisation, stemming, and cleaning raw text data
  • Feature extraction: Converting text to numerical representations (word embeddings)
  • Classification models: Neural networks like BERT or simpler algorithms like Naive Bayes
  • Output interpretation: Scoring systems (e.g., -1 to +1) or emotion categories
  • Feedback loops: Continuous learning from new data via Major LLMs Data Availability

How It Differs from Traditional Approaches

Traditional sentiment analysis relied on manual rules and basic keyword matching. Modern AI agents use deep learning to understand context - detecting sarcasm in “Great, another delayed flight” as negative despite positive words. Stanford HAI research shows transformer models achieve 20-30% higher accuracy than rule-based systems.

Key Benefits of AI Agents for Sentiment Analysis

Real-time processing: Analyse thousands of documents in seconds, enabling immediate response to emerging trends. Tools like FirmOS specialise in high-volume streaming analysis.

Cost efficiency: Automating sentiment analysis reduces manual review costs by up to 70% according to McKinsey.

Scalability: Handle seasonal spikes in customer feedback without adding staff, as demonstrated in our guide on streamlining customer service with AI agents.

Consistency: Eliminate human bias and fatigue in repetitive analysis tasks.

Actionable insights: Generate dashboards and alerts when sentiment shifts significantly, like Blackbox AI does for financial markets.

Multilingual support: Advanced models like those from H2O.ai analyse sentiment across 100+ languages without separate rule sets.

AI technology illustration for neural network

How AI Agents for Sentiment Analysis Works

The sentiment analysis pipeline involves four key stages, each building on the previous step’s outputs.

Step 1: Data Collection and Preparation

Agents ingest text from APIs, databases, or scraped sources. Preprocessing removes noise like HTML tags, normalises text (lowercasing), and handles special characters. For example, BentoML includes built-in text cleaning modules for common formats.

Step 2: Feature Engineering

Transform text into machine-readable formats using techniques like:

  • Bag-of-words representations
  • TF-IDF weighting
  • Word embeddings (Word2Vec, GloVe)
  • Contextual embeddings (BERT, RoBERTa)

Our guide on LLM model selection details embedding tradeoffs.

Step 3: Model Training and Fine-Tuning

Select an appropriate algorithm based on data size and complexity:

  • Rule-based: VADER for social media text
  • Classical ML: SVM, Random Forest
  • Deep Learning: LSTMs, Transformers

OpenAI’s research shows fine-tuned models achieve 5-15% higher accuracy than off-the-shelf versions.

Step 4: Deployment and Monitoring

Package models into production-ready services using frameworks like BentoML. Monitor for concept drift - when language patterns change over time - and retrain as needed.

Best Practices and Common Mistakes

What to Do

  • Start with clear objectives: Are you detecting overall sentiment or specific aspects?
  • Use domain-specific training data: Medical sentiment differs from product reviews
  • Implement human review loops for edge cases
  • Combine with other metrics as shown in automating workflows with AI

What to Avoid

  • Assuming one model fits all languages/domains
  • Ignoring model explainability requirements
  • Overlooking deployment costs - see LLM technical documentation guide
  • Failing to update models with new slang/expressions

FAQs

How accurate is AI sentiment analysis?

Top models achieve 85-95% accuracy on benchmark datasets, but real-world performance varies by domain. Anthropic’s research shows adding human review for 5% of cases catches most errors.

What industries benefit most from sentiment analysis?

Retail, finance, and healthcare lead adoption. Our AI in healthcare 2025 report details medical applications like patient feedback analysis.

How much data do I need to start?

500-1000 labelled examples per sentiment category provide decent baseline performance. Uizard offers templates for common use cases.

When should I use sentiment analysis vs. full text analysis?

Sentiment works for emotional tone detection. For deeper insights like topics or intent, combine with techniques from our RAG vs fine-tuning guide.

Conclusion

AI agents for sentiment analysis transform unstructured text into actionable emotional insights, with applications from customer service to market research. Key success factors include quality training data, proper model selection, and continuous monitoring.

For implementation, explore specialised agents like WellSaid Labs for voice data or Open Set Recognition for handling unknown sentiment categories. Continue learning with our guide on building recommendation AI agents or browse all AI agents for your specific needs.

RK

Written by Ramesh Kumar

Building the most comprehensive AI agents directory. Got questions, feedback, or want to collaborate? Reach out anytime.